Abstract

The efficacy of different inhibitors in mineral and synthetic base oils in conditions of high-temperature catalytic oxidation was investigated. It was found that all of the inhibitors investigated only slowed the oxidation reaction in mineral oils, while three of the inhibitors totally stopped the reaction in synthetic oil. The efficacy factors of the inhibitors for different base oils were determined.
